Output d4a0c60ef9ebb3854079c681fc37c9094d3e5509fdea7e132422da5464faa3bd:104

value
29265
script pubkey
OP_0 OP_PUSHBYTES_20 6a0ad441145a2ae7c5148c9731c9d2b443092b4c
address
bc1qdg9dgsg5tg4w03g53jtnrjwjk3psj26vvs39k6
transaction
d4a0c60ef9ebb3854079c681fc37c9094d3e5509fdea7e132422da5464faa3bd
confirmations
183907
spent
true